Course Details

• Equity in Health and Social Care Policy: An Introduction
• Historical Context of Health and Social Care Inequities
• Determinants of Health: Understanding Social Inequalities
• Policy Analysis and Evaluation for Health Equity
• Intersectionality and Health Disparities
• Human Rights and Social Justice in Health and Social Care
• Inclusive Health and Social Care Policy: Strategies and Approaches
• Stakeholder Engagement and Collaboration in Health Equity
• Monitoring and Evaluating Equity in Health and Social Care Outcomes

As a Policy Analyst, you can expect 250 job listings. This role involves evaluating existing policies, understanding policy impacts, and recommending improvements to promote equity in health and social care. Healthcare Consultants can find 300 job opportunities. These professionals work with healthcare organisations, helping them improve service delivery, efficiency, and equity. Public Health Professionals can access 200 job listings. This role includes designing, implementing, and monitoring health promotion programs, ensuring that they cater to diverse communities and reduce health disparities. Social Care Specialists can explore 180 job opportunities. These professionals collaborate with social care organisations to develop equitable policies, programs, and services that address the needs of marginalised and vulnerable populations. Lastly, Equity and Inclusion Consultants can expect 150 job listings. This role focuses on advising organisations on eliminating discriminatory practices and fostering a more inclusive environment for diverse staff and users.
